Output 39d2118c2004aee78acdb91131aeafecdb08fc2d2b0d5bb63f4e5aef36e95938:1

value
109300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13a59621b9b830e16262aedaa470f69517e9fc4a OP_EQUAL
address
33Uu8LVfQoboCC8xarbyD6U4C8oxzav3FT
transaction
39d2118c2004aee78acdb91131aeafecdb08fc2d2b0d5bb63f4e5aef36e95938
confirmations
309482
spent
true